The formula bar comes very handy when you are dealing with a pretty long formula and you want to view it entirely without overlaying the contents of the neighbor cells. You can use it to enter a new formula or copy an existing one. But if you are a novice in Microsoft Excel, you might want to learn the basics first, and one of the essentials is the Formula Bar.Įxcel formula bar is a special toolbar at the top of the Excel worksheet window, labeled with function symbol ( fx).
